Strawberry Sauce

  • Total Time: 10 minutes
  • Yield: 2 cups 1x
  • Diet: vegetarian

Description

A delicious homemade strawberry sauce perfect for desserts and toppings.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b fresh or frozen strawberries (if using frozen, do not thaw)
  • 1/3 cup granulated sugar
  • 3 tbsp water
  • 1 tbsp corn starch
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• pinch of lemon zest
  • splash of lemon juice

Instructions

  1. Stir together the cornstarch and water in a small bowl, making sure the cornstarch is fully dissolved.
  2. Add this and remaining sauce ingredients to a pot on the stove over medium heat.
  3. Stir, and bring the mixture to a simmer.
  4. Once simmering, cook for 5 minutes, stirring constantly.
  5. Remove from heat and allow to cool. You can cool the sauce quickly by pouring it into a shallow bowl or pie plate and placing in the fridge for 20-30 minutes.

Notes

  • Store in the fridge in an airtight container until ready to use.
  • This keeps for 1 to 1 and 1/2 weeks in the fridge.
